Introduction to Hazelnut Lattes

A hazelnut latte is a type of coffee drink that combines espresso, steamed milk, and hazelnut syrup or flavoring. The drink’s origins date back to the early 20th century, when hazelnut-flavored coffee became popular in Europe. Today, hazelnut lattes are a staple in coffee shops around the world, with their rich, nutty flavor captivating the hearts of many.

Ingredients and Flavor Profile

The sweetness of a hazelnut latte depends on several factors, including the type and amount of hazelnut syrup or flavoring used, the ratio of espresso to milk, and the type of milk used. A traditional hazelnut latte typically consists of:

  • 2 shots of espresso
  • 3-4 oz of steamed milk
  • 1-2 pumps of hazelnut syrup or 1/4 teaspoon of hazelnut flavoring

The hazelnut syrup or flavoring is the primary contributor to the drink’s sweetness. Hazelnut syrup is made from hazelnuts, sugar, and water, with some brands containing more sugar than others. The amount of syrup used can significantly impact the overall sweetness of the latte.

Factors Influencing the Sweetness of a Hazelnut Latte

Several factors can influence the perceived sweetness of a hazelnut latte, including:

  • Type of milk used: Whole milk, skim milk, and non-dairy milk alternatives like almond milk or soy milk can affect the sweetness level of the latte. Whole milk tends to add a richer, sweeter flavor, while non-dairy milk alternatives can result in a slightly bitter taste.
  • Ratio of espresso to milk: A higher ratio of espresso to milk can result in a bolder, more bitter flavor, while a higher ratio of milk to espresso can make the drink sweeter.
  • Amount of hazelnut syrup used: As mentioned earlier, the amount of hazelnut syrup used can significantly impact the sweetness level of the latte.
  • Personal taste preferences: Individual taste preferences play a significant role in determining the perceived sweetness of a hazelnut latte. Some people may find a hazelnut latte overly sweet, while others may find it not sweet enough.

Can I make a Hazelnut Latte without an espresso machine?

While an espresso machine is typically used to make a Hazelnut Latte, it is not strictly necessary. There are several alternatives that can be used to make a similar drink without the need for an espresso machine. One option is to use strongly brewed coffee, which can be made using a French press or drip coffee maker. This coffee can then be combined with steamed milk and hazelnut syrup to create a drink that is similar to a Hazelnut Latte.

Another option is to use a stovetop espresso maker, which can be used to make a shot of espresso without the need for an electric machine. These makers work by forcing pressurized hot water through finely ground coffee beans, producing a concentrated shot of coffee that can be used as the base for a Hazelnut Latte. Additionally, there are also a number of instant espresso powders and coffee concentrates that can be used to make a Hazelnut Latte without the need for any special equipment. By using one of these alternatives, you can still enjoy a delicious and authentic Hazelnut Latte without the need for an espresso machine.
